A sinusoidal sound wave moves through a medium and is described by the displacement wave function

Physics
1 answer:
labwork [276]2 years ago
7 0

By applying the wave equation we know that the displacement on the y-axis is 1.999 micrometers.

We need to know about wave equations to solve this problem. The displacement of the wave on the y-axis can be explained by the wave equation

y = A cos (kx - ωt)

where y is y-axis displacement, A is amplitude, k is wave number, x is x-axis displacement, ω is angular speed and t is time.

the wavenumber and angular speed of the wave equation can be determined respectively by

k = 2π / λ

ω = 2πf

where k is the wavenumber, λ is wavelength and f is frequency.

From the question above, we know that:

y = 2.00cos (15.7x - 858t)

(x in meters, t in second, y in micrometers)

x = 0.05 m

t = 3 ms

Convert time to second

t = 3ms = 0.003 s

By applying the wave equation, we get

y = 2.00cos (15.7x - 858t)

y = 2.00cos (15.7(0.05) - 858(0.003))

y  = 2 cos(-1.789)

y = 1.999 micrometers

2. A 200.0-kg bear grasping a vertical tree slides down at constant velocity. What is the friction force between the tree and th
Neporo4naja [7]

Answer: 1960 N

Explanation:

The bear is sliding down at constant velocity: this means that its acceleration is zero, so the net force is also zero, according to Newton's second law:

F_{net}=ma=0

There are two forces acting on the bear: its weight W, pulling downward, and the frictional force Ff, pulling upward. Therefore, the net force is given by the difference between the two forces:

F_{net}=W-F_f=0

From the previous equation, we find that the frictional force is equal to the weight of the bear:

F_f=W=mg=(200.0 kg)(9.8 m/s^2)=1960 N

Two girls,(masses m1 and m2) are on roller skates and stand at rest, close to each other and face-to-face. Girl 1 pushes squarel
Arturiano [62]

Answer:

\vec{v}_1 = -\frac{\vec{v}_2m_2}{m_1}

Explanation:

The center of mass of the system (two girls) is constant, as the velocity of the center of mass of the system is also constant.

\vec{v}_{cm} = \frac{m_1\vec{v}_1 + m_2\vec{v}_2}{m_1 + m_2}

<u>The initial velocity of the system is zero, since both girls are at rest.</u> So the velocity of the total system at any point should be zero as well.

0 = \frac{m_1\vec{v}_1 + m_2\vec{v}_2}{m_1 + m_2}\\\vec{v}_1 = -\frac{\vec{v}_2m_2}{m_1}

This is true, because there is no friction between the girls and the ground. Otherwise, the velocity of the center of mass wouldn't be constant.

The apparent backward movement of a planet is called
babymother [125]
The answer is D. Most of the rotational and orbital motions in the solar system are in the same "eastward" direction. Motions in this direction are referred to as direct motions while motions in the opposite direction are referred to as retrograde. Retrograde motion is the apparent backward motion of a planet caused by its being lapped by another planet or vice versa. Both planet move in a direct eastward motion around the sun, but the planet with the inside (smaller) orbit moves faster than the planet on the outside (larger orbit), and when it passes the slower moving planet, each sees the other one as apparently moving backward relative to its motion around the sky.
